Gain Sharing. eFunds shall work with Deluxe to identify potential savings in the Services and shall make recommended changes to the methods and processing used by Deluxe. Upon mutual agreement, the identified potential savings or improved processing techniques shall be researched and a proposal shall be presented to Deluxe. eFunds' proposal shall include the estimated current costs, the recommended changes and the projected savings or service improvements to Deluxe and a proposed Work Order setting forth each party's responsibilities to achieve the savings or improvements. In the case of improved Services, a mutually agreed to value shall be assigned to such improved Services and shall be used as the basis for any gain sharing. Upon the parties' execution of a Work Order, a Project Plan shall be developed by eFunds to accomplish the change. Deluxe shall compensate eFunds for such savings or service improvements upon successful implementation as follows, as the parties may elect in writing at the time of the relevant Work Order's execution: (a) for any change initiated by eFunds resulting in the savings or improved Services benefiting Deluxe, eFunds shall retain fifty percent (50%) of the savings or value in improved Services for a period of twelve (12) months, after which all further savings or enhanced value shall be realized by Deluxe; and (b) for any change initiated by Deluxe but as to which eFunds has substantially assisted, either (i) Deluxe shall retain one hundred percent (100%) of the savings or enhanced value and eFunds will be compensated directly through Fees for its implementation Services or (ii) eFunds shall retain thirty-five percent (35%) of the savings or enhanced value for a period of twelve (12) months, after which all further savings or enhanced value shall be realized by Deluxe.
